Transaction e98709ac8676f80099f9037cfd47f5268348b1386a244246dc1b2e8bbbbeb803

1 Input
2 Outputs
  • e98709ac8676f80099f9037cfd47f5268348b1386a244246dc1b2e8bbbbeb803:0
  • value  25462
    address  3FsSK74P3wdYu5wffW5ApgRBWcdv9jBw6b
  • e98709ac8676f80099f9037cfd47f5268348b1386a244246dc1b2e8bbbbeb803:1
  • value  1770572
    address  35UsPNfsDHDQ4AznHBQgyzTC1Xdh4T94ty